Born in Philadelphia to Italian immigrants, Frank and Anna Pinciotti, he was the 7th of 13 children.
He was a brilliant man and was involved in many school activities including the 6 footers club, band and baseball. He was biology club president and class senator. He also had 2 letters in sports.
After graduation he served with honor in the United States Airforce. He was well thought of and respected by his superior officers and peers.
Upon returning to Philadelphia, he married the love of his life Marie Puglia in 1956. They went on to raise 5 amazing children.
Joe accepted Jesus Christ as Lord and Savior as a young man. He was a lifelong member of the Italian Pentecost church. Later in life he attended Calvary Chapel of Philadelphia. There he was involved with the over 50’s ministry.
He was a member of the IUOE 542, as a heavy equipment operator.
Joes hands were as big as a baseball mitts from hard work but his heart was bigger. He could never say no to a favor, having rescued all of children, relatives, and the occasional stranger from mechanical failures of all sorts. We don’t think he knew how to sit down.
He loved all little children, especially his many grandchildren. He loved to play with them and make them laugh. They adored him.
He was a kindhearted and gentle man with an amazing sense of humor. He never met a stranger who didn’t become an instant friend.
He loved his family and they loved him dearly as well.
He will be terribly missed by family, friends and neighbors.
He was a great man.
Joe was preceded in death by his parents and eleven siblings. He is survived by his wife of almost 70 years Marie, children Ruth(Tom Shegda), Joseph Jr(Debra), Lynne(David Austin), Mark (Michelle) and Caren, sister Anna, seven grandchildren, six great grandchildren plus innumerable in- laws, nieces, nephews and cousins.
